Wind farm fund is open for bids

Non-profit organisations based within a ten-mile radius of a windfarm are being urged to get in touch for the chance to be given a cash boost.
The closing date for the Grange Wind Farm Community Fund is fast approaching on January 1, 2023.
Not-for-profit community groups and registered charities, along with schools, parish councils and churches who are based within a 10-mile radius of The Grange Wind Farm, located between Sutton Bridge and Tydd St Mary may apply for up to £5,000 per round.
General running costs may now be considered for existing projects to support groups through the cost-of-living crisis.
Over the last year, the fund has supported Tydd St Mary Parish Council in providing safety surfacing area for the Tydd Gote play area and has supported Long Sutton Cricket Club in renovating their showers, toilets and changing facilities.
